Judgment text excerpt

The Supreme Court upheld the High Court's conviction of the appellants under Sections 302 and 498A IPC, emphasizing the validity of the dying declaration made by the deceased, Smt. Roshni, which detailed the circumstances of her death and the harassment she faced. The Court found that the dying declaration, corroborated by the evidence presented, was sufficient to establish the guilt of the accused. The appellants were sentenced to life imprisonment for murder and additional imprisonment for the dowry-related offense, affirming the High Court's judgment.
